What is a part time remote PHP developer?

A Part Time Remote PHP Developer is a software professional who specializes in using the PHP programming language to build and maintain web applications, working fewer hours than a full-time employee and performing their duties remotely. These developers collaborate with teams or clients online, often using project management tools and version control systems. Their tasks typically include writing clean PHP code, debugging, integrating databases, and ensuring website functionality. The remote and part-time nature of the job offers flexibility in work schedule and location, making it ideal for those seeking work-life balance or supplementary income.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time remote PHP developer?

To thrive as a Part Time Remote PHP Developer, you need a solid understanding of PHP programming, web development fundamentals, and experience with databases like MySQL, often supported by a relevant degree or coding bootcamp. Familiarity with frameworks such as Laravel or Symfony, version control systems like Git, and remote collaboration tools is typically required. Strong time management, problem-solving skills, and effective communication are essential soft skills for remote work success. These skills ensure high-quality, maintainable code delivery and seamless collaboration in a distributed work environment.

How do part-time remote PHP developers typically collaborate with team members and manage communication challenges?

Part-time remote PHP developers often work with distributed teams using collaboration tools like Slack, Jira, or Trello to stay aligned on project goals and tasks. Regular check-ins via video calls or chat help ensure everyone is on the same page, despite different work schedules. Clear documentation and proactive communication are essential to manage hand-offs and avoid misunderstandings. Many teams also use version control systems, such as Git, to streamline code sharing and reviews. Building strong communication habits is key to overcoming the challenges of working remotely and part-time.

Senior Power Systems Engineer

Electric Power Engineers

Toronto, ON • On-site, Remote

Part-time

Medical, Dental, Vision, Retirement, PTO

Re-posted 6 days ago


Job description

Overview

We are designing the Grid of the future.

Conduct power system studies and analysis for meeting regulatory compliance requirements of existing and future NERC and regional reliability standards. This position will have specific emphasis placed on generating facilities' planning, modeling, operation and protection system analysis.

Responsibilities

How you can make an impact:

  • Perform detailed bulk power system studies using various power system software such as PSCAD, PSSE, and TSAT.

  • Conduct IBR modeling: steady state, short circuit and dynamic.

  • Perform various compliance technical assessments on IBR facility rating, protection coordination, ride through assessment.

  • Process, generate and maintain data as required for other engineering related studies.

  • Prepare technical study reports for all studies performed.

  • Take responsibility for the timely completion of projects assigned while meeting all project quality and budget objectives.

  • Be able to provide on the job training or help oversee the work of other Power Systems Engineers and Interns.

  • Execute on multiple studies/tasks at any given time.

  • Perform complex tasks according to good engineering practice and EPE procedures.

  • Capable of autonomously and independently executing on assigned tasks.

  • Participate in multifunctional teams to obtain/provide input, address client comments, and perform technical studies.

  • Assist in developing tools, processes, and procedures that enhance engineering study completion.

Qualifications

Bring your passion, here's what's needed:

  • Master's degree in electrical engineering with an emphasis in power systems

  • At least 5 years of experience as a power systems engineer

  • Experience with performing power system impact studies such as Steady State, Short Circuit, and Dynamic Stability

  • Experience with power systems software such as PSCAD, PSSE, and TSAT

  • Experience with automating/programing in Python
